Property from the Loyd Collection
JOSEPH MALLORD WILLIAM TURNER, R.A.
London 1775 - 1851
WHALLEY BRIDGE AND ABBEY, LANCASHIRE: DYERS WASHING AND DRYING CLOTH
oil on canvas
61.2 by 92 cm.; 24⅛ by 36¼ in.
Probably commissioned by Thomas Lister Parker (1779–1858)
J. Newington Hughes Esq.
His sale, London, Christie’s, 15 April 1847, lot 145, to Brown
Wynn Ellis (1790–1875), by 1850/51
His sale, London, Christie’s, 6 May 1876, lot 118, to Agnew on behalf of Lord Overstone
Samuel Jones-Loyd, 1st Baron Overstone (1796–1883)
Thence by inheritance to his son-in-law Brigadier-General Robert Loyd-Lindsay, 1st Baron Wantage, VC, KCB, VD (1832–1901), Lockinge, Oxfordshire
Thence by descent
